Hi Jason. I'm sure you'll be successful, but it's always best to double-check that you have everything you need before you buy the products. In regards to the sealant, it depends on the materials you'll be working with. Different types of sealants are suitable for different types of driveways, so it's essential to do your research and pick the right ones. As for the sprayer for sealant, you're right that it needs to be cleaned after use to avoid clogging. As for pressure washing different types of brick and patios, the general idea is the same, but you should also research the specific materials and techniques you should use for each one.
